21st Golden Boll Film Festival

Ankara Cinema Association organized the International programme of the 21st Adana Golden Boll Film Festival held between 15-21 September.

The films in the World Cinema Section are Two Days, One Night (Two Days, One Night by Dardenne Brothers, Leviathan by Andrey Zvyagintsev, Goodbye to Language by Jean-Luc Godard, Maps to the Stars by David Cronenberg, The Wonders by Alice Rohrwacher, Mr. Turner by Mike Leigh, Jimmy’s Hall by Ken Loach, Misunderstood (Incompresa) by Asia Argento, Human Capital by Paolo Virzi, Timbuktu by Abderrahman Sissako, Difret by Zeresenay Berhane Mehari, White Shadow by Noaz Deshe, Silvered Water, Syria Self-Portrait by Wiam Simav and Ossama Mohammed, Inbetween Worlds (Between Worlds) by Feo Aladağ, Two Men in Town (The Way of the Enemy) by Rachid Bouchareb, To Kill a Man (To Kill A Man) by Alejandro Fernandez Almendras, Stratos by Yannis Economides, Black Coal, Thin Ice (Bai Ri Yan Huo) by Diao Yinan, The Way Out (Cesta Ven) by Petr Vaclac and Correction Class (Klass Korrekzii) by Ivan I. Tverdovsky.

THREE COUNTRY, THREE FILMS: AZERBAIJAN, KAZAKHISTAN, KYRGYZTAN

The films in this section are Down the River (Downstream) by Asif Rustamov, The Owners by Adilkhan Yerzhanov and Taxi and Telephone by Ernest Abdyjaparov.

MAYBE JUST A WHISTLE: BACALL, BOGART

The films in this section are To Have or Not to Have and The Big Sleep by Howard Hawks and Key Largo by John Huston.

CHARLIE CHAPLIN: 125 YEARS OLD

The Great Dictator (1940) was shown for the 125th anniversary of Charlie Chaplin.

SHAKESPEARE FOREVER: 450 YEARS OLD

The films in this section are Hamlet (1948) by Sir Laurence Olivier, The Tragedy of Othello: The Moor of Venice by Orson Welles (1952) and Romeo and Juliet by Baz Luhrmann (1996)

IN MEMORIAM: TUNCEL KURTİZ

Dark Shadows of Fear (Dunkle Schatten der Angst) (1992) was shown in memoriam for the great actor Tuncel Kurtiz.

DOCUMENTARIES

The films in this section are Motör aka Remake Remix Rip-off by Cem Kaya, A Dream School in the Steppes (Tepecik Dream School) by Güliz Sağlam, Fertile Memory (Al Dhakira Al-Khasba) by Michel Khleifi, Our Terrible Country (Baldna Al-Raheeb) by Mohammad Ali Atassi and Ziad Homsi, The Beekeper (The Beekeeper) by Mano Khalil, Midsummer Night’s Tango (Mittsommernachstango) by Viviane Blumenschein, Stream of Love (Love Streams) by Ágnes Sós, Echo of the Mountain (Echo de la Montana) by Nicolás Echevarría.
